'''Availability:''' Extremely rare. First appeared in Tutta colpa del paradiso (''All the Fault of Paradise''), and later seen on some films such as Stregati (''Bewitched''), ''Il Piccolo Diabolo'' (''The Little Devil''), ''La leggenda del santo bevitore'' (''The Legend of the Holy Drinker'') and ''Fantozzi va in pensione'' (''Fantozzi Retires''). The variant appears on the 1987 film ''Io e mia sorella'' (''Me and My Sister'').


'''Final Note:''' In 1989, Columbia Pictures Italia was renamed to [[Sony Pictures Releasing International|Columbia TriStar Films Italia]] and has continued to distribute titles under that name.
'''Final Note:''' In 1989, Columbia Pictures Italia was renamed to [[Sony Pictures Releasing International|Columbia TriStar Films Italia]] and has continued to distribute titles under that name.
